Hollandaise Sauce (Dutch Sauce): A warm emulsified sauce is based on egg yolks and clarified butter. Nantua Sauce - is a classical French sauce consisting of: a Béchamel sauce base cream crayfish butter crayfish tails It is named for the city of Nantua, which is known for its crayfish, and the term à la Nantua is used in classical French cuisine for dishes containing crayfish. Sauce Choron: Prepare a Sauce Béarnaise, omitting the final addition of tarragon and chervil and keeping it fairly thick, add up a quarter of its volume of tomato puree which has been well concentrated or reduced in order that the addition will not alter the consistency of the sauce. Sauce Paloise: Prepare a Béarnaise but while doing this replace the principle flavouring of tarragon with the same quantity of mint in the reduction of white wine and vinegar and replace the chopped tarragon with chopped mint at the final stage. Brown Sauce Derivatives (Demi-Glace) Bordelaise - Red Wine Reduction / Poached Marrow Chasseur - Mushroom / Shallot / White Wine / Tomato concass Lyonnaise - Onions fried in butter Madeira - Madeira Wine Prigueux - Chopped Truffles / Madeira Robert - White Wine / Onions / Mustard / Butter. Sauce Normande: To fish veloute-add mushroom liquor and cooking liquor from mussels and fish stock, all in equal proportions, a few drops of lemon juice and thickening of egg yolks with cream. The concept of mother sauces predated Escoffier's classification by at least 50 years; in 1844, a French magazine called "Revue de Paris" reported: "Oui ne savez-vous pas que la grande espagnole est une sauce-mère, dont toutes les autres préparations, telles que réductions, fonds de cuisson, jus, veloutés, essences, coulis, ne sont, à proprement parler, que des dérivés?"
